meviy, an on-demand custom parts manufacturing service developed by MISUMI Group, Inc., has upgraded its sheet metal processing capabilities. Engineers and designers can now work with increased inch-based thicknesses and a broader range of supported hole sizes, including tapped and countersunk hole options, according to the MISUMI Group.
This latest update offers more design freedom while maintaining speed and simplicity, according to MISUM Group. With enhanced support for sheet thicknesses up to 0.5 inches, and bending available up to 0.25 inches, customers can shift more parts from milled components to sheet metal.
